In the fourth volume of the MAXX series, readers are drawn deeper into the complex tapestry of Sarah's life, exploring her struggles and the blurred line between reality and the surreal. This installment highlights her tumultuous journey, bridging her emotional landscapes with the vibrant yet chaotic world of the MAXX. As Sarah confronts her fears and desires, the narrative provides a rich, introspective look at her psyche and motivations.
The artistry of Sam Kieth complements the storytelling with striking visuals that evoke the dreamlike quality of Sarah's experiences. Each panel captures the fluidity of her shifting perceptions, creating a sensory experience that mirrors her internal conflicts. The collaboration with William Messner-Loebs and Alan Moore further amplifies the depth of the narrative, weaving in philosophical undertones and character development that resonate on multiple levels.
As Sarah’s story unfolds, the boundaries between her waking life and the strange, paralleled realm of the MAXX begin to blur. Readers are left contemplating the nature of reality and the impact of memories, all while engaging with the unique artistry that has come to define the series. The journey is filled with twists and revelations, making this volume a pivotal moment in the ongoing saga.
